Ben Wheatley is Directing ‘The Meg 2’ for Warner Bros!

The director of Kill List, SightseersA Field in England, High-Rise, and Netflix’s Rebecca, Ben Wheatley has been hired by Warner Bros to direct the shark attack sequel The Meg 2!

Now that’s an (unexpectedly) inspired choice!

The scoop comes courtesy of The Hollywood Reporter tonight, and the site also reports that The Meg star Jason Statham is expected to return and be “creatively involved.”

The script has been written by Dean Georgaris and Jon & Erich Hoeber.

Jon Turteltaub’s The Meg, based on Steve Alten’s Meg novels, was released in theaters back in 2018, devouring over $500 million at the worldwide box office. Jason Statham starred as heroic shark-slayer Jonas Taylor, part of a group of scientists exploring the Mariana Trench who encounter the largest marine predator that has ever existed – the Megalodon.
